Sweat-based hydration tests, at their core, analyze the electrolyte content of your sweat to gauge your overall hydration status. They seem simple enough: sweat a little, analyze the sample, and get a reading. But the reality is far more complex, particularly when altitude enters the equation.

Denver’s altitude, averaging around 5,280 feet above sea level, presents a unique physiological challenge. The lower air pressure means less oxygen is available, forcing your body to work harder. This increased exertion leads to increased respiration and, consequently, greater fluid loss.

Seniors, already more susceptible to dehydration due to age-related physiological changes like decreased thirst sensation and reduced kidney function, are particularly vulnerable in this environment. Their bodies may not adapt as efficiently to the altitude, exacerbating fluid loss.

Here’s where the problem with sweat tests arises: at altitude, your body’s sweat composition changes. You might sweat more, and the concentration of electrolytes in your sweat can be altered due to the body’s attempt to regulate fluid balance in the face of increased respiratory water loss. A standard sweat test, calibrated for sea-level conditions, might incorrectly indicate adequate hydration when you’re actually dehydrated and losing crucial electrolytes.

So, what’s the solution? Ditch sweat tests altogether? Not necessarily, but they need to be interpreted with extreme caution and supplemented with other assessment methods.

First, understand the limitations. A single sweat test provides a snapshot in time and doesn’t account for individual variations in sweat rate, electrolyte composition, or acclimatization to altitude.

Second, consider alternative assessment methods. These include:

  • Urine Color: A simple, yet effective indicator. Aim for pale yellow, like lemonade. Darker urine suggests dehydration.
  • Thirst Sensation: While diminished in seniors, it’s still a valuable cue. Don’t ignore it.
  • Skin Turgor: Gently pinch the skin on the back of the hand. If it snaps back quickly, you’re likely well-hydrated. Slow return indicates dehydration.
  • Daily Weight Monitoring: A sudden drop in weight can signal fluid loss.
  • Blood Electrolyte Tests: A more accurate, albeit invasive, method to assess electrolyte levels. Consult with a physician to determine if this is necessary.

Third, adjust your hydration plan based on activity level and altitude. A sedentary senior in Denver will have different hydration needs than an active one hiking in the foothills.

  • Pre-hydration: Start hydrating well before any activity.
  • Consistent Intake: Sip fluids throughout the day, not just when thirsty.
  • Electrolyte Replacement: Consider electrolyte-rich drinks or foods, especially after exercise.
  • Listen to Your Body: Pay attention to signs of dehydration, such as headache, dizziness, or muscle cramps.

Common pitfalls to avoid:

  • Relying solely on sweat tests: As we’ve established, they’re not foolproof in Denver.
  • Ignoring thirst: Especially crucial for seniors with diminished thirst sensation.
  • Drinking only when thirsty: Proactive hydration is key.
  • Over-hydrating: Can lead to electrolyte imbalances.
  • Assuming all fluids are equal: Water is essential, but electrolytes are also crucial.
  • Not adjusting for activity level: A sedentary lifestyle requires less hydration than an active one.
